Identifying Opportunity
It’s no secret that both baggy and high-waisted jeans are trending. But our design team also kept hearing that our curvier fans couldn’t find baggy jeans that fit properly around the waist. Seeing an opportunity to create one product that could deliver on both fronts, our designers set to work to design a jean that was versatile and flattering on all different body types.
“We’re the global denim leader, and it’s our responsibility to drive innovation and set the future trends of the category,” shared Jill Guenza, VP, Design Women’s Apparel at Levi’s®. “When our fans are coming to us with specific fit and fashion needs, it’s our job to deliver.”
Innovation Meets Heritage
The design solution to our fans’ request was surprisingly simple — a straight-leg baggy jean with adjusters on the back for a truly “tailored-to-you” fit. This design gives wearers the flexibility to style the jeans low-rise or high-waisted — essentially getting two looks in one pair — while eliminating the waist gap.
“When it comes to jeans, versatility is key, especially in today’s denim era,” said Jill. “We wanted to create a jean that works for every body type, while giving people the flexibility to adapt their look for any occasion. And we needed to do it in a way that felt authentic to us and to our history.”
While trends may come and go, high-quality, staple pieces are timeless. Consulting with our LS&Co. Archives, our design team reviewed styles from throughout our over 170-year history, drawing inspiration from the original Levi’s® 501® jean, Lady Levi’s® jeans and even our classic Trucker jacket, which features adjusters on its hem.
Enter: Cinch Baggy jeans, an innovation that honors our past, while styling us for the future.
The Viral Moment
The social response to Cinch Baggy was overwhelmingly positive. In early March alone, TikTok search volume for the jean hit over 200M, with influencers and everyday shoppers alike raving about the versatility and fit. Fashion outlets like Harper’s Bazaar featured the fit, sharing, “It’s tough to convince me to add a new pair of jeans into my rotation, but I’m already thinking up occasions when I can put the side snaps to use. Besides being functional, there’s something fun about clothes that you can DIY to your liking.”
“It was pretty incredible to see the organic pickup and viral response to the product,” said Kellie Hansen, director of Global Social Media for Levi’s®. “When we saw the acceleration in conversation with consumers, we wanted to take back some ownership — so we partnered with our Styling team to create content rooted in product education, which was really well received.”
